Ans: It is a process of evaluating the responsiveness, speed, stability, and scalability of a software application under various conditions. Performance testing assesses how well an application performs under different load levels and stress conditions. Performance Testing ensures that the application can handle the expected user load and response times without crashing or slowing down.
Ans: The main types of performance testing include load testing, stress testing, endurance testing, and spike testing. Load testing involves evaluating an application's performance under expected load levels, stress testing assesses its behaviour under extreme conditions, endurance testing checks its stability over extended periods, and spike testing examines its response to sudden spikes in user activity.
Ans: Virtual users are simulated users that mimic real users' behaviour to test the application's performance. It emulates the actions of actual users, sending requests to the application's servers, and generating realistic load scenarios to determine how the application handles different usage patterns. Ans: Scalability testing checks how well an application can scale up or down to accommodate changing user loads, while load testing focuses on determining the maximum capacity an application can handle. Scalability testing assesses an application's ability to handle varying loads smoothly by adding or removing resources. Load testing, on the other hand, identifies the breaking point of an application by subjecting it to increasing levels of load until performance degrades or it crashes.

Ans: Baseline testing establishes a performance benchmark for the application under normal conditions. Baseline testing provides a reference point against which future performance measurements can be compared. It helps identify performance deviations and improvements over time.
Ans: Memory leaks occur when an application does not release the memory it no longer needs, leading to performance degradation. To analyse memory leaks, memory profiling tools are used to monitor an application's memory usage over time. Comparing memory snapshots before and after a load test helps identify potential leaks.
Ans: Throughput measures the number of transactions an application can handle in a given time period. Throughput indicates an application's processing capacity and helps assess its efficiency in managing user requests. It is typically measured in transactions per second (TPS).
Ans: Application Performance Monitoring involves collecting and analysing data to gain insights into an application's performance. APM tools track metrics such as response times, resource utilisation, and error rates to help optimise application performance.
Ans: Performance bottlenecks are areas of an application where performance is degraded. They can be addressed through various techniques, such as code optimisation, database tuning, and load balancing. Identifying bottlenecks involves analysing performance data, profiling code, and using monitoring tools to pinpoint resource-intensive components. Once identified, bottlenecks can be addressed through appropriate optimisations.
Ans: A Performance Test Lead oversees the performance testing process, manages the testing team, and collaborates with stakeholders to ensure successful performance testing. It plans and executes performance tests, defines testing strategies, monitors results, and communicates findings to the development team and stakeholders. They play a critical role in achieving a high-performance application.
Ans: Cloud-based performance testing offers scalability, flexibility, and cost-efficiency compared to traditional on-premises testing. It allows you to simulate diverse user loads, access a wide range of environments, and pay only for the resources used during testing, making it a cost-effective solution for performance testing.
Ans: Benchmark testing involves running tests to establish a performance baseline, while load testing simulates real-world usage to evaluate an application's behaviour under stress. Benchmark testing focuses on setting performance standards, whereas load testing evaluates how an application performs under varying load conditions, helping to identify bottlenecks and weaknesses.
Ans: Performance testing directly impacts user experience by ensuring that applications are responsive, reliable, and capable of handling user demands without delays. Performance testing helps prevent slow response times, crashes, and other performance-related issues that could negatively affect user satisfaction. Ans: Spike testing evaluates how an application responds to sudden spikes in user activity or load. Spike testing helps identify an application's capacity to handle unexpected traffic surges, such as during a product launch or a marketing campaign.
Ans: The endurance testing assesses an application's stability and performance over an extended period. Endurance testing is essential to ensure an application remains reliable and responsive under sustained loads, helping identify memory leaks, resource exhaustion, and other long-term performance issues.
Ans: Determining the right load involves analysing user behaviour, understanding application requirements, and gradually increasing the load until performance indicators start degrading. By studying user patterns, reviewing business goals, and collaborating with stakeholders, you can establish load scenarios that closely resemble real-world usage and reveal an application's breaking point. Ans: Common challenges include defining realistic load scenarios, capturing accurate performance metrics, and interpreting test results effectively. Performance testing can be complex due to the dynamic nature of applications and the various factors influencing performance. Overcoming these challenges requires a combination of technical expertise and effective communication.
Ans: Response time measures the time it takes for an application to respond to a user's request. Response time is a critical performance metric as it directly impacts user experience. It helps evaluate an application's speed and responsiveness under different loads.
Ans: Simulating realistic load involves mimicking user behaviour, utilising user scenarios, and generating traffic patterns that resemble actual usage. By analysing user personas, transaction patterns, and usage data, you can design load tests that accurately resemble real-world scenarios, helping identify potential performance bottlenecks.

Ans: Soak testing involves subjecting an application to a constant load for an extended period to identify performance degradation over time. Soak testing helps uncover memory leaks, resource exhaustion, and other issues that may not be apparent during shorter load tests. It ensures an application's long-term stability.
Ans: Stress testing pushes an application to its limits by applying extreme load conditions. Stress testing identifies the application's breaking point and helps understand how it behaves under adverse conditions, such as high user loads or resource constraints.
Ans: Analysing performance test results involves comparing metrics against baseline values, identifying deviations, and pinpointing performance bottlenecks. By constantly reviewing response times, throughput, error rates, and resource utilisation, you can draw insights into an application's strengths and weaknesses, guiding optimisation efforts. Ans: Performance testing in CI/CD pipelines ensures that code changes do not negatively impact an application's performance as it moves through development stages. Integrating performance testing into CI/CD pipelines helps catch performance regressions early, enabling developers to address issues promptly and deliver high-quality code.
Ans: Key performance metrics include response time, throughput, error rate, and resource utilisation (CPU, memory, network). Monitoring these metrics provides insights into an application's health and performance characteristics, aiding in the identification of bottlenecks and areas of improvement.
Ans: Ramp-up periods gradually increase the load on an application, while ramp-down periods gradually decrease the load. Ramp-up and ramp-down periods mimic real-world scenarios where user loads build up and subside gradually. These periods help identify how an application adapts to changing loads.
Ans: Addressing performance issues in production involves closely monitoring the application, identifying root causes, and applying targeted fixes. By utilising monitoring tools and performance analytics, you can quickly identify issues, whether they stem from coding errors, database inefficiencies, or other factors, and take corrective actions.
Ans: Automated performance testing offers consistency, repeatability, and faster feedback compared to manual testing. Automated tests can be run consistently, allowing you to reproduce test scenarios easily and detect performance regressions early in the development cycle.
Ans: A/B Testing involves comparing the performance of two versions of an application or component to determine which one performs better. A/B testing helps make informed decisions about performance optimisations by directly comparing different implementations and identifying the one that provides better performance.
Ans: While both stress and load testing evaluate an application's performance, stress testing focuses on pushing the application to its limits, whereas load testing simulates real-world usage. Stress testing aims to identify the breaking point of an application, while load testing assesses its performance under varying levels of user activity, helping ensure its stability and responsiveness.
Ans: Performance testing assists in capacity planning by providing insights into an application's resource requirements under different load scenarios. By conducting performance tests at various load levels, you can determine an application's capacity needs, aiding in provisioning the right amount of resources for optimal performance.
Ans: Performance testing contributes to business success by enhancing user satisfaction, reducing downtime, and maintaining brand reputation. High-performance applications attract and retain users, drive revenue, and build trust with customers, ultimately leading to improved business outcomes. Ans: Load distribution ensures that user requests are evenly distributed across application components and servers. Proper load distribution prevents overloading specific components, helping maintain application stability and preventing performance bottlenecks.
Ans: Real-time monitoring provides immediate insights into an application's performance during testing, allowing quick identification of issues. Real-time monitoring enables proactive responses to performance deviations, helping ensure that potential bottlenecks or issues are addressed promptly. Ans: Key considerations for mobile application performance testing includes network conditions, device fragmentation, and user interactions. Mobile application testing should account for variations in network speed, different device specifications, and user behaviours, ensuring optimal performance across various scenarios.
Ans: Test data management involves creating and maintaining realistic test data to simulate real-world scenarios. Proper test data management ensures that performance tests accurately replicate real usage patterns, providing reliable insights into an application's behaviour under different conditions.
Ans: Performance testing indirectly affects application security by identifying potential vulnerabilities under different load conditions. It can help uncover security vulnerabilities that might only manifest under heavy loads, enabling organisations to address both performance and security concerns simultaneously.
Ans: Failover testing assesses an application's ability to switch to a backup system, while recovery testing evaluates how well an application can recover after a failure. Failover testing focuses on maintaining service availability, while recovery testing addresses the process of returning an application to normal operation after a failure. Ans: Network latency refers to the delay in data transmission between client and server due to network constraints. Network latency directly affects application response times, particularly in distributed systems. Performance testing should account for varying network conditions to provide accurate insights.
Ans: Distributed load testing involves distributing virtual users across multiple machines to simulate realistic user traffic. By coordinating the load from multiple machines, you can simulate diverse user behaviours and ensure that the application's components work harmoniously under different conditions.
Ans: While both performance testing and load testing assess an application's behaviour, performance testing encompasses various test types, including load testing, to evaluate overall system performance. Load testing focuses solely on evaluating an application's behaviour under varying load levels, while performance testing encompasses a broader spectrum of tests that ensure the application meets desired performance criteria.

Ans: Ramp-down periods are crucial in load testing as they gradually decrease the load on an application. Unlike ramp-up periods that simulate the gradual increase in user load, ramp-down periods simulate users leaving the system gradually. This helps observe how the application behaves as load reduces, reflecting real-world scenarios. Ans: Correlation is crucial in performance testing as it helps maintain the integrity of scripts by managing dynamic values such as session IDs. It involves extracting data from server responses and passing it to subsequent requests. Handling correlation involves identifying dynamic values, capturing them, and replacing them in subsequent requests, ensuring script accuracy.
Ans: Network congestion and latency can be simulated using tools that introduce delays and simulate various network conditions. These tools mimic real-world network challenges, allowing you to observe how an application performs under adverse conditions, helping identify potential bottlenecks and response time delays. Ans: Analysing resource utilisation metrics provides insights into an application's resource consumption, helping identify resource-intensive areas and potential bottlenecks. High CPU usage can lead to slow response times, while memory leaks can cause performance degradation. Monitoring network traffic helps ensure network-related issues do not affect performance.
Ans: "Think time" representing the interval between user actions in a scenario. It simulates the time users spend thinking or interacting with the application between actions. Incorporating realistic think times in performance testing scenarios helps accurately replicate user behaviour and provides more accurate performance insights.
Ans: Microservices pose challenges such as increased complexity, distributed architecture, and inter-service communication. Testing each service's performance in isolation and under varying loads, along with simulating real-world communication patterns, can help address these challenges.
Ans: Caching improves performance by storing frequently accessed data. During performance testing, you can measure the impact of caching by comparing response times and resource utilisation with and without caching. Varying cache expiration times and load scenarios helps determine the caching strategy's effectiveness. Ans: Testing third-party integrations involves creating mock services to simulate APIs or collaborating with third-party providers to use non-production environments. Consider factors like API response times, error handling, and data consistency while testing to ensure integrations do not impact overall application performance.
Ans: Measuring response times at different percentiles provides insights into performance under varying conditions. While average response time gives an overall view, higher percentiles (e.g., 95th, 99th) indicate performance at worst-case scenarios, helping identify performance issues that might affect a small percentage of users. Ans: "Headless" performance testing refers to testing without a graphical user interface (GUI), focusing solely on the backend. This approach is useful for load testing APIs, microservices, or server-side components without the overhead of rendering GUI elements. It offers faster test execution, resource efficiency, and allows targeting specific functionalities for testing.
